#786090 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#786090 is composed of 47.1% red, 37.6%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 47.1%. #786090 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0c0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#786090 color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.

#786090 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#786090 has RGB values of R:120, G:96,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 7889040.

Shades and Tints of #786090

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#786090

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78727e is the less saturated color, while #7804ec is the most saturated one.
